There are a lot of wonderful platforms built for the purpose of collecting and sharing family history and photos but with so many previous failed attempts at sharing, which to choose?<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Begin with the End in Mind<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image alignright size-medium\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"300\" height=\"300\" src=\"https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/image-2-300x300.png\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-4229\" srcset=\"https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/image-2-300x300.png 300w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/image-2-1021x1024.png 1021w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/image-2-150x150.png 150w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/image-2-768x770.png 768w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/image-2-500x500.png 500w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/image-2.png 1134w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><figcaption class=\"wp-element-caption\"><em>One of my favorite coffee shops in Nashville. <\/em><\/figcaption><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">As 2020 came to a close, I clarified my mission. With a pencil, paper, and coffee (always coffee) in hand, I brainstormed. What did I want to accomplish? What was my desired outcome? Who was my target audience? What kind of time investment was reasonable? What would bring me satisfaction?<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">I decided to skip a generation. My generation kindly had tried to stifle their yawns. They tried to keep their eyes from rolling when I talked about family history. They feigned interest as I identified folks in antique photos. I had bored them enough. I decided that my target audience would be our children, nieces, and nephews. If a group of millennials is my target audience, how best to reach them? <\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Instead of inviting them into my world, I&#8217;ll take my world to them.<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">I was inspired by a circus in Louisville KY. When the pandemic forced closure, they took their show to the streets. You could arrange with the circus and they would bring their acts to your neighborhood for socially distanced parties and celebrations. The circus pivoted and delivered appropriately-sized personal parties to you. Why not do the same with a Family History Circus?<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Inviting family to read blog posts or to scroll through my ancestry.com family tree didn&#8217;t work. So rather than creating another something that would require my target audience to take action to gain access, I decided to experiment with delivering appropriately-sized family history stories on a street they travel every single day: Instagram.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">I just wanted to plant some seeds.<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image alignleft size-medium is-resized\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"142\" height=\"300\" src=\"https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/20200404_163032-142x300.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-4227\" style=\"width:218px;height:auto\" srcset=\"https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/20200404_163032-142x300.jpg 142w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/20200404_163032-485x1024.jpg 485w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/20200404_163032-768x1623.jpg 768w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/20200404_163032-727x1536.jpg 727w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/20200404_163032-969x2048.jpg 969w, https:\/\/elizadhill.com\/artofrecollection\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/07\/20200404_163032-scaled.jpg 1211w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 142px) 100vw, 142px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">I enjoy Instagram.
